A few pics of frames I tried on today. Looking for a daily optical frame. Thoughts?

JMM William in Havana. I think these would make a great all day optical, titanium temples. Ideally would like them in the London color.

Apologies in advance because I’m sure this has been asked a million times but the search function didn’t help. Is it possible to swap lenses at home without heating up the acetate? I’m not overly concerned about the lenses but I’m definitely concerned about the frames.

Apologies in advance because I’m sure this has been asked a million times but the search function didn’t help. Is it possible to swap lenses at home without heating up the acetate? I’m not overly concerned about the lenses but I’m definitely concerned about the frames.

Are you a member of Aroma's FB BST group? One of the mods posted a short video tutorial on how to "cold snap" JMM lenses, as long as they're not the Last Frontier or any other JMM frame that uses glass lenses
